)]}'
{
  "commit": "444ca887d9ee50e6f551f8e58396865fb9573485",
  "tree": "3d004693c7aded9c322e59b94ef3105bd435cee5",
  "parents": [
    "622989e30568e960e958d5d9a3cf7e62cda5ffb4"
  ],
  "author": {
    "name": "Ignas Anikevicius",
    "email": "240938+aignas@users.noreply.github.com",
    "time": "Thu Dec 12 02:21:20 2024 +0900"
  },
  "committer": {
    "name": "GitHub",
    "email": "noreply@github.com",
    "time": "Wed Dec 11 17:21:20 2024 +0000"
  },
  "message": "ci: fix CI after bazel 8 release (#2492)\n\nSummary:\n* Remove the old `7.x` config from all `.bazelrc`.\n* Drop bazel 6 from example testing/support. The `.bazelrc`\n  for enabling `WORKSPACE` cannot work across bazel 6,7,8.\n* Add missing `BUILD.bazel` file for integration tests.\n* Remove an integration test runner for `bazel 6.x`.\n* RBE test for bazel 8 is still not working. \n* bump `rules_java` for internal WORKSPACE dependencies to\n  a version that supports `8.x`.\n* start running bazel-in-bazel integration tests using bazel `8.x`.\n* until bazel-contrib/rules_bazel_integration_test#414 is merged,\n  we need to use bazel 7 for the delete_packagese pre-commit hook,\n  not sure about how to track this as the `cgrindel/bazel-lib` needs\n  a new version.\n\nFixes #2378\n\n---------\n\nCo-authored-by: Richard Levasseur \u003crichardlev@gmail.com\u003e",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"8c0252c3c8769c69ca8f6401a3743e58ce48a28b",
      "old_mode": 33188,
      "old_path": ".bazelci/presubmit.yml",
      "new_id": "f1a912cf8022067e38bc20bc8eaf474366b40fc9",
      "new_mode": 33188,
      "new_path": ".bazelci/presubmit.yml"
    },
    {
      "type": "modify",
      "old_id": "c44124d961a5feecb74cba16cc9b40a3eb72d983",
      "old_mode": 33188,
      "old_path": ".bazelrc",
      "new_id": "ada5c5a0a7991e5de5947a53a0d481845365a58c",
      "new_mode": 33188,
      "new_path": ".bazelrc"
    },
    {
      "type": "modify",
      "old_id": "35907cd9caaf234e2f769bf782a28591cb894e1d",
      "old_mode": 33188,
      "old_path": ".bazelversion",
      "new_id": "c6b7980b681fcc9565b6735ec2f40bcaf8e687a9",
      "new_mode": 33188,
      "new_path": ".bazelversion"
    },
    {
      "type": "modify",
      "old_id": "707a8d78aa373937036614b92a1caed14d7c0b69",
      "old_mode": 33188,
      "old_path": ".pre-commit-config.yaml",
      "new_id": "2b451e89fa73ecc6fc0ba651ffc4edd4c36510d0",
      "new_mode": 33188,
      "new_path": ".pre-commit-config.yaml"
    },
    {
      "type": "modify",
      "old_id": "bcf9f523241b9e63bf583320a13c8fc521d093dc",
      "old_mode": 33188,
      "old_path": "CHANGELOG.md",
      "new_id": "1f84193e6276d2d839025de437e7a27e0a7fc5a1",
      "new_mode": 33188,
      "new_path": "CHANGELOG.md"
    },
    {
      "type": "modify",
      "old_id": "e4b113e785e578bb9da81faeb7f8233bf9d8b696",
      "old_mode": 33188,
      "old_path": "MODULE.bazel",
      "new_id": "57780b23696034d8a34d8ea2a7bb55ab12e86ebb",
      "new_mode": 33188,
      "new_path": "MODULE.bazel"
    },
    {
      "type": "modify",
      "old_id": "c0d9f33a9bff04febb9522b09b0f280afec99bae",
      "old_mode": 33188,
      "old_path": "WORKSPACE",
      "new_id": "6e9e85ac1e22576cff62b289bf5f745464a67089",
      "new_mode": 33188,
      "new_path": "WORKSPACE"
    },
    {
      "type": "modify",
      "old_id": "fd0f731d2f9c400345afd7abf9f1c034cd242905",
      "old_mode": 33188,
      "old_path": "examples/build_file_generation/.bazelrc",
      "new_id": "306954d7beff83a516c3441dc612495feaf1b93d",
      "new_mode": 33188,
      "new_path": "examples/build_file_generation/.bazelrc"
    },
    {
      "type": "modify",
      "old_id": "a56904803cc85e3132a15f25113df7d4f2beb5f7",
      "old_mode": 33188,
      "old_path": "examples/pip_parse/.bazelrc",
      "new_id": "f263a1744d458646b7d0b0ef0740179ba4e89939",
      "new_mode": 33188,
      "new_path": "examples/pip_parse/.bazelrc"
    },
    {
      "type": "modify",
      "old_id": "be3555d1ebdc3ad880f4ab83c4518bf89587b482",
      "old_mode": 33188,
      "old_path": "examples/pip_parse_vendored/.bazelrc",
      "new_id": "a6ea2d91384dca0c333340986d9d974603ddbb06",
      "new_mode": 33188,
      "new_path": "examples/pip_parse_vendored/.bazelrc"
    },
    {
      "type": "modify",
      "old_id": "d8932279461bf0fa899e3702991fb2e056dcf825",
      "old_mode": 33188,
      "old_path": "examples/pip_repository_annotations/.bazelrc",
      "new_id": "c16c5a24f2de63c0195032135178a876da8571f0",
      "new_mode": 33188,
      "new_path": "examples/pip_repository_annotations/.bazelrc"
    },
    {
      "type": "modify",
      "old_id": "d73fc5387a396442043d576f0a9a3c17b4fd210c",
      "old_mode": 33188,
      "old_path": "examples/py_proto_library/.bazelrc",
      "new_id": "2ed86f591e9f80d4b1284fada2e9e4b1fc1e38a1",
      "new_mode": 33188,
      "new_path": "examples/py_proto_library/.bazelrc"
    },
    {
      "type": "modify",
      "old_id": "e76ee48e83965b5a6683fcf1ed478191323b65a3",
      "old_mode": 33188,
      "old_path": "internal_dev_deps.bzl",
      "new_id": "0304fb16b751cf3b59b49c53cde625ad0cc0428d",
      "new_mode": 33188,
      "new_path": "internal_dev_deps.bzl"
    },
    {
      "type": "modify",
      "old_id": "d6e95e22ce73d199ca351816458f59c81f6ac825",
      "old_mode": 33188,
      "old_path": "internal_dev_setup.bzl",
      "new_id": "fc38e3f9c5cc7cff50f30a078a49fd72ee77551f",
      "new_mode": 33188,
      "new_path": "internal_dev_setup.bzl"
    },
    {
      "type": "modify",
      "old_id": "3422ef14fa952f91c6dc3143b2e1fa0432b656af",
      "old_mode": 33188,
      "old_path": "python/BUILD.bazel",
      "new_id": "b747e2fbc7dd14eefc0a1ab920060490baa781a3",
      "new_mode": 33188,
      "new_path": "python/BUILD.bazel"
    },
    {
      "type": "modify",
      "old_id": "21355ac939c8b1af0096b4f100cf087f0443e128",
      "old_mode": 33188,
      "old_path": "python/runtime_env_toolchains/BUILD.bazel",
      "new_id": "5001d12556fea344317db13af563fcbb357149cb",
      "new_mode": 33188,
      "new_path": "python/runtime_env_toolchains/BUILD.bazel"
    },
    {
      "type": "modify",
      "old_id": "289c85d38afa038f9cae2c801d13d9693475c74f",
      "old_mode": 33188,
      "old_path": "tests/integration/BUILD.bazel",
      "new_id": "d178e0f01c2ce5e19a9bbbafb1bceba5cef9d152",
      "new_mode": 33188,
      "new_path": "tests/integration/BUILD.bazel"
    },
    {
      "type": "modify",
      "old_id": "61fb81efd4beccb987a6efdc91230ac5b35547ae",
      "old_mode": 33188,
      "old_path": "version.bzl",
      "new_id": "4d85b5c4209dde48c2bcbc520f2599a83301347f",
      "new_mode": 33188,
      "new_path": "version.bzl"
    }
  ]
}
